MAP17: Hell Sunrise is the seventeenth map of Bloodspeed. It was designed by ChaingunnerX and Memfis, and uses a MIDI rendition of "Undersea Maze" by Jamie McMenamy, from Anvil of Dawn, as its music track.

Secrets[edit]

  1. In a small room with a blood pool with a cage in the middle, get on the leftmost block on the north wall (you will have to strafejump to get it). Look south and shoot the switch, then enter the blood and head southeast to an armor bonus and a teleporter. The teleporter takes you to health bonuses and a switch that lowers the blue key. (sector 63)
  2. Pick up the blue key and head to the northeast part of the map. Open the blue door to find armor bonuses, boxes of rockets, and a soul sphere. (sector 592)
